Title: Norbert Rittmannsberger: Innovator in Vehicle Brake Systems

Introduction

Norbert Rittmannsberger is a notable inventor based in Stuttgart,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of vehicle brake systems, holding a total of 5 patents. His innovative designs focus on enhancing the functionality and reliability of braking systems in motor vehicles.

Latest Patents

Rittmannsberger's latest patents include a vacuum motor for vehicle brake systems. This vacuum motor features a first chamber and a second chamber separated by a movable wall, with a third chamber that connects to atmospheric pressure. This design allows for effective traction control by generating an adjusting force on a multi-circuit master cylinder. Another significant patent is for an anti-skid and traction control apparatus for vehicles. This system includes a master brake cylinder and a pressure control valve assembly that optimizes the flow of pressure fluid between the wheel brake and the master brake cylinder, ensuring both safety and performance.
